ETM Group to open three new London sites

By Mark Wingett

ETM Group, the London-­based pub restaurant operator led by Tom and Ed Martin, is to open three new sites in the capital before the end of the year, including a 11,000sq ft pub & restaurant at the Nova development in Victoria.

Henry Harris cuts ties with The Dog & Badger before launch

By Emma Eversham

Former Racine chef Henry Harris has left his job as chef-patron at The Dog & Badger, the Buckinghamshire bar and restaurant he was planning to re-launch this month due to 'artistic differences' with the owner.

What vegetarians want when they eat out

By Emma Eversham

Veggie burgers, meat-free sausages and vegetable lasagnas no longer cut the mustard with vegetarian diners, a survey has found with many requesting chefs create innovative dishes using plant-based products instead of meat substitutes.
